Hello,
Posting the question since i didn't see API command for CM to stop/start service on a specific host. I'm not asking for decommission/recommission as this will require blocks to be copied prior to eviction. This is to facilitate OS patching and will be pretty quick probably 2-3 hour downtime.

There is an API endpoint for starting all roles on a host: https://archive.cloudera.com/cm7/7.2.4/generic/jar/cm_api/apidocs/resource_ClouderaManagerResource.h...
For stopping all roles on a host, you have to iterate in your script/code over all role instances deployed on the host, and stop them one after the other.
